Javascript is a programming language that is widely used across the internet. Many websites, including Google's search functionality as well as most blogs and content management systems depend on javascript to function. In addition to these, it can be used for more advanced application development as well as client-server architecture. Yarn is a JavaScript package manager that greatly improves the experience of using JavaScript in projects. It allows you to install packages with a simple command, saving you hours of time and headaches looking for compatible versions of packages and their dependencies.
